TI Calculator Feature Comparison
| Model | Price Range | Primary Use | Functions | Battery Life | Exam Approval |
|---|---|---|---|---|---|
| TI-84 Plus CE | $100-$150 | Graphing | 480+ functions | 2-4 weeks | SAT, ACT, AP approved |
| TI-89 Titanium | $120-$180 | Advanced Math | 1000+ functions | 1-2 weeks | Limited approval |
| TI-Nspire CX II | $150-$200 | STEM Education | 2000+ functions | 1-2 weeks | SAT, ACT approved |
| TI-36X Pro | $25-$40 | Scientific | 200+ functions | 3+ years | SAT, ACT, FE approved |
| TI-30X IIS | $15-$25 | Basic Scientific | 100+ functions | 5+ years | SAT, ACT approved |

Key Factors That Affect What Is The Best TI Calculator Results
1. Intended Academic Level: The grade level and subject area significantly influence what is the best TI calculator. Elementary and middle school students typically need basic scientific calculators, while high school students often require graphing capabilities for algebra, geometry, and calculus courses.
2. Examination Requirements: Standardized tests have specific calculator policies that directly affect what is the best TI calculator choice. SAT, ACT, AP, and IB exams each have different approval lists, and choosing a non-approved calculator renders it useless during testing.
3. Budget Constraints: Price points vary dramatically among TI calculators, from under $20 for basic models to over $200 for advanced graphing calculators. Understanding your budget helps narrow down what is the best TI calculator within your financial means.
4. Required Functionality: Different academic disciplines require specific calculator capabilities. Engineering students need CAS systems, while statistics students benefit from built-in statistical functions. This factor heavily influences what is the best TI calculator selection.
5. Battery Life and Durability: Long-term use considerations affect what is the best TI calculator. Students planning multi-year use need calculators with good battery life and robust construction to withstand daily use.
6. Software and Updates: Modern TI calculators offer updatable operating systems and downloadable applications. This factor determines what is the best TI calculator for users who want access to new features and educational tools over time.
7. Interface and Usability: Display quality, button layout, and navigation systems impact user experience. These elements influence what is the best TI calculator for individuals with different comfort levels and learning styles.
8. Connectivity Options: Modern educational environments often require calculators with USB connectivity for data transfer, classroom networking, and software updates, affecting what is the best TI calculator for contemporary learning.
